UniCredit Zagrebačka banka (UniZaba) is the second largest bank in the country. Total assets increased by 18% to € 948 m year-on-year; loans to customers rose by 15%, total deposits by 18%. Over half of all customer deposits are savings deposits in retail banking and thus provide a solid funding base for further business expansion.
Retail customers:
In 2006 the segment focused on introducing new products (cash loans for VISA Classic card holders, e-banking services, the JES account package, etc.) successfully. Loans rose by € 74 m and deposits by € 53 m. The branch network is divided into 10 regions within Bosnia and Herzegovina; direct sales channels were further expanded. The network of ATMs was extended and now numbers 89 machines.
Corporate customers:
UniZaba successfully implemented e-banking services for corporate customers in 2006. New loans for a total volume of € 114 m were extended and guarantees in the amount of € 60 m were concluded. The bank focused on expanding its strong position in business with medium-sized companies.
Outlook:
UniCredit Zagrebačka banka and HVB Central Profit Banka will merge in the final quarter of 2007; the new bank will have about 100 branches and will be the market leader in all of its business segments.
